Travis Furmanski

During the week of September 29th, Cedar Crest senior Travis Furmanski added another milestone to his already remarkable running career by capturing the Paul Short Invitational title at Lehigh University. Competing against nearly 1,100 runners across three divisions, Furmanski posted a winning time of 14:53.8, which not only secured the victory but also stood as the fastest overall time at the prestigious event. The effort marked a 55-second personal best and further solidified his place among Pennsylvania’s elite high school runners — earning him recognition as the LebCoSports.com Athlete of the Week.

Furmanski’s performance at Lehigh is another step in a senior season that has him well on his way to becoming a local legend in the running community. His goals for the remainder of the fall include winning Lancaster-Lebanon League and District 3 titles — both individually and as a team — while also pursuing a top-three finish at the PIAA State Championships. Beyond that, he has his sights set on qualifying for Nike or Brooks Nationals, where he hopes to showcase his talent on a national stage.

As a senior leader, Travis sets the pace for his teammates through his focus and example. “I lead the way for our team as we try to go after league and district championships,” he said, noting that his success wouldn’t be possible without the people who have pushed him to improve. “My coaches push me to be better every day.”

Cedar Crest Cross Country coach Brandon Risser praised his standout runner, saying, “Travis is a tough competitor who has earned everything that he has achieved in this sport. His development into an elite Cross Country performer has been a highlight of my coaching journey and an inspiration to his teammates.”

In addition to his cross country success, Furmanski excels on the track — placing seventh in the 3200m at last spring’s PIAA State Championships — and plans to continue his athletic career in college while pursuing a degree in business or engineering.

Outside of running, Travis stays active with 4-H and FFA animals and enjoys hunting in his free time

For Travis, the sport’s rewards go well beyond medals and finish times. “The friendships made through sports,” he said, are what make the journey most meaningful.
